| No picture available | Alistair Riddoch has been involved in Free Software development since late 1996 when he joined the Linux 8086 kernel project, also know as ELKS, which he lead from Summer 1997 until the end of 1999. Alistair joined the WorldForge project in March 2000 and became coordinator of key parts of WorldForge in late 2000. He managed the release of the Acorn demo in July 2001 and is currently working on the transition to the next phase of WorldForge development. Alistair complete his masters degree in Electronic Engineering at the University of Southampton in 1997, and spent a year working as a Software Engineer at Philips Semiconductors, before returning to Southampton as a Systems Programmer. His current role also includes teaching interactive entertainment systems to undergraduates. 2002-04 |
